1. Information We Collect
The information collected depends on the features you choose to use:
- Account and profile information: name, email address or phone number, account identifier, profile image, authentication records, role, and notification preferences.
- Business, staff, and customer information: business name and address, contact details, branding, staff roles, customer or guest details, bookings, notes, and support messages entered by you or an authorized business user.
- Operational and financial information: inventory, purchases, sales, payment references, expenses, receivables, payables, payroll, audit history, appointments, reservations, and other records needed to provide the selected business modules.
- Sensitive module information: optional records entered in features such as clinic or pharmacy workflows may include patient, prescription, or other health-related information.
- Location: precise or approximate location when you use a location-dependent feature, such as attendance verification, and network-derived location used for security or service configuration.
- Photos and files: optional logos, profile images, product images, support attachments, prescriptions, or business documents that you choose to upload.
- Device and diagnostics: app installation identifiers, push-notification tokens, device and operating-system information, app interactions, crash reports, performance diagnostics, IP address, and security logs.

3. Storage and Security
Mechia stores offline working data in the app's protected device storage and synchronizes eligible records to our cloud services when cloud features are enabled. Network traffic is encrypted in transit using TLS. Cloud records are protected by tenant-scoped access controls, including database row-level security. Authentication secrets and tokens use operating-system protected storage where supported.
4. Service Providers and Disclosures
We use service providers only to operate requested features. These may include Supabase-compatible infrastructure for authentication, database and Edge Functions; Cloudflare services for network protection and object storage; Google Firebase for analytics, crash reporting, remote configuration and push notifications; payment providers such as Flutterwave or Mobile Money operators; and email, SMS, or WhatsApp providers selected for communications. Payment information sent to a payment provider is handled under that provider's privacy terms. We may also disclose information when required by law or to protect users and the service.
5. Retention and Account Deletion
We retain active account and business information while the account is in use and as needed to provide the service. Security logs, deletion-verification records, and records subject to legal obligations may be kept for a limited period. Routine encrypted backup copies are isolated from normal use and expire under a rolling retention schedule.
Account owners can initiate deletion inside Mechia under Settings > Account > Delete account. People who no longer have the app can use our web account-deletion page. After identity verification, we delete the account and associated cloud data unless a specific record must be retained by law. Deleting cloud data does not remove copies previously exported by the user or independently held by a payment or communications provider.
